Chicago Cubs Cubs MLB Preview
The Chicago Cubs enter their July 12, 2025 matchup against the New York Yankees as one of the most balanced and intriguing teams in the National League, leading the NL Central with a 55–39 record and showcasing a roster that blends emerging young talent with proven veteran contributors. Despite being slight underdogs at Yankee Stadium, the Cubs have covered the spread in seven of their last ten appearances in the Bronx, a testament to their ability to compete in hostile environments and rise to the occasion against marquee opponents. Their offensive attack has been led by Pete Crow-Armstrong, whose combination of speed, bat control, and defensive brilliance in center field has turned heads all season, and Kyle Tucker, who has delivered consistent power from the middle of the lineup. Seiya Suzuki has also found his rhythm at the plate, providing clutch hits and a disciplined approach that helps extend innings and wear down opposing pitchers. Ian Happ, a switch-hitter with sneaky power and solid on-base skills, rounds out a top four that is capable of putting pressure on even the most elite rotations. Against left-handed starters like Max Fried and Carlos Rodón, the Cubs have had mixed results in 2025, which could present a challenge in this series, but their lineup’s flexibility and approach-oriented mentality gives them a chance to grind out runs.
The pitching staff has been a steady strength, with Saturday’s starter Matthew Boyd posting a surprising All-Star-caliber season with a 2.52 ERA, mixing speeds effectively and keeping hitters off-balance with a revamped changeup and slider combination. Boyd’s resurgence has been a critical development for a Cubs team that has needed innings and stability behind Justin Steele and Jordan Wicks, and he’ll be tasked with navigating a Yankees lineup that features multiple All-Star bats and excels in hitter-friendly parks like Yankee Stadium. The bullpen remains a work-in-progress but has shown resilience, with Adbert Alzolay anchoring the closer role and Hector Neris providing late-inning support. Defensively, the Cubs are one of the league’s sharper teams, particularly up the middle with Nico Hoerner at second base and Dansby Swanson at shortstop, giving Boyd a reliable defensive backbone that helps the team stay in games even when the bats go quiet. Bench depth has also emerged as a strength, with players like Patrick Wisdom and Miguel Amaya stepping into roles when needed and delivering key moments, especially in road series. Manager Craig Counsell has received praise for his tactical flexibility and ability to manage pitching matchups, a skill that will be vital as the Cubs look to neutralize the Yankees’ power game. For Chicago, this series against New York is an opportunity to measure themselves against another World Series-caliber roster while continuing to solidify their grip on the division lead. If Boyd can pitch deep into the game and the offense can scratch out a few early runs, the Cubs could once again defy the betting odds and remind the league why they’re a legitimate threat to win it all in 2025.

New York Yankees Yankees MLB Preview
The New York Yankees enter their July 12, 2025 matchup against the Chicago Cubs in excellent spirits, having won five straight games and looking to extend their dominance at home in the Bronx. Sitting at 52–41 and well within reach of the AL East crown, the Yankees are finally finding consistency after a shaky June that saw them go 10–16 and lose traction in the standings. A big reason for the turnaround has been the resurgence of their pitching staff and the continued excellence of Aaron Judge, who remains a top-tier MVP candidate with his towering home run total, disciplined plate approach, and gold glove–level defense in right field. Judge continues to carry the offense, but the Yankees have also received timely production from other core players like Jazz Chisholm Jr., whose athleticism and spark have transformed the top of the lineup, and Cody Bellinger, who is finally healthy and delivering key hits with runners in scoring position. Saturday’s starter, Max Fried, has been nothing short of dominant in 2025 with an 11–2 record and a 2.27 ERA, utilizing his fastball-curveball mix to keep hitters off balance and control the tempo of games. His ability to go deep into outings has been critical, especially given the Yankees’ earlier struggles in the bullpen. While the pen is still a work-in-progress, Clay Holmes has regained some of his 2022 form in the closer role, and lefty Wandy Peralta has been dependable as a high-leverage setup man.
Defensively, the Yankees remain strong, with Anthony Volpe and Oswald Peraza combining for a slick double-play tandem up the middle, and Bellinger offering range and arm strength in center field. Behind the plate, Austin Wells continues to develop his game-calling and framing abilities, which has helped the staff settle in as the season has progressed. Manager Aaron Boone has also managed to keep the lineup fresh with strategic days off and smart late-game substitutions, and his decision-making will be key against a deep Cubs team that thrives on exploiting mistakes. The Yankees will aim to get to Cubs starter Matthew Boyd early, as Boyd has been effective this year but has occasionally struggled when his pitch count climbs quickly. If New York can take pitches, draw walks, and force the Cubs to go to their bullpen before the seventh inning, they could break the game open in the later frames. With Yankee Stadium’s short porches and their power-laden lineup, the Yankees are always a threat to put up crooked numbers quickly, and that will be a key factor in a game expected to be close throughout. A win on Saturday not only keeps the Yankees hot heading into the All-Star break but also sends a message that this team is ready to contend deep into October, especially as their rotation continues to perform at a championship level and the offense continues to fire on all cylinders.
